24 November 2025, Worsley
Housebuilders Story Homes and Taylor Wimpey have exchanged contracts with Peel Land Group to purchase land at Hazelhurst Farm in Worsley, paving the way for a significant new residential development
Subject to planning approval, the scheme will deliver a total of 330 high-quality family homes, with Story Homes building 155 properties and Taylor Wimpey delivering 175. Both developers are committed to providing 50% affordable housing as part of the plans, with 20% being delivered at Hazelhurst Farm and the remainder via an off-site affordable housing contribution.
A planning application is currently being drafted for this exciting new project and will be submitted to Salford City Council in the coming weeks.
Story Homes and Taylor Wimpey will offer a range of one to six-bedroom homes, designed to meet the needs of modern families at all stages of life. The wider development will bring substantial benefits to the local community, including approximately five hectares of new open space and landscaping, Biodiversity Net Gain (BNG), land for a new primary school, and essential highways improvements.
In line with the Section 106* agreement for the scheme, the housebuilders will contribute over £15.3 million towards local infrastructure and amenities, including off-site affordable housing, education, sports, highways, allotments, and other community facilities. This investment will support local services, ensuring the development delivers long-term benefits for the area.

Peel Land Group was advised throughout the transaction by Roger Hannah, whose expertise helped facilitate the agreement.
In addition to addressing local housing need, the scheme is expected to bring economic benefits to Worsley and the surrounding areas, including the creation of construction jobs, use of local subcontractors, and increased demand for local services once the homes are occupied.
